Why Saigontel Is Moving Now
Vietnam's digital economy has been expanding at a pace that's making regional data center operators nervous about capacity. Southeast Asia broadly is projected to see data center demand grow substantially through the late 2020s, driven by cloud adoption, mobile internet penetration, and an accelerating push by multinationals to diversify their infrastructure away from single-country concentration in markets like Singapore.
Saigontel isn't just responding to demand — it's trying to get ahead of a land crunch that has already started squeezing competitors.
For context: Singapore has effectively run out of developable land for large-scale data centers, prompting a government moratorium that lasted from 2019 to 2022 and still carries strict sustainability conditions. Developers who didn't secure land positions early paid the price in delays, cost overruns, and lost deals. Vietnam watched that play out. Saigontel appears to have internalized the lesson.
By accumulating reserves now — between five and twenty hectares per site — the company is building optionality. That range matters. A five-hectare site can support a mid-scale hyperscale deployment or a colocation campus serving regional enterprise clients. Twenty hectares opens the door to something significantly more ambitious: a multi-building data center campus with dedicated power substations, redundant fiber entry points, and room to expand in phases without displacing operations.
Land Is the Hardest Part of the Problem
Anyone who has worked through a data center site selection process knows that power and land are the two constraints that kill deals. Power gets most of the attention — and for good reason, given that a large data center can draw 100+ megawatts — but land acquisition in emerging markets carries its own brutal complexity.
In Vietnam specifically, land tenure rules, provincial approval processes, and the gap between designated industrial zones and actually shovel-ready sites have historically slowed development timelines. Getting a clean land use right certificate, confirming that soil conditions support heavy foundation loads, and verifying that the site sits outside flood zones and seismic risk areas — these aren't bureaucratic formalities. They're deal-breakers when they go wrong.
Saigontel's existing presence in Vietnamese industrial real estate gives it a structural advantage here that a foreign developer parachuting in simply cannot replicate.
The company understands the local regulatory environment, has existing relationships with provincial authorities, and — critically — already has experience with the land conversion processes required to shift parcels from one designated use category to data center-compatible development. That institutional knowledge has real dollar value and isn't reflected in any headline announcement.
What This Means for the Surrounding Ecosystem
Data center campuses don't exist in isolation. A twenty-hectare development generates construction employment during the build phase, then transitions into highly skilled permanent operational roles — electrical engineers, facilities technicians, network operations staff. In regions where that kind of stable technical employment is scarce, the economic multiplier effect is meaningful.
Beyond direct employment, there's the infrastructure pull-through effect. Fiber carriers route capacity toward data center clusters. Power utilities upgrade transmission infrastructure to serve anchor load customers. Roads get improved. Ancillary businesses — equipment suppliers, security firms, maintenance contractors — establish local presence. The data center becomes a nucleus.
For surrounding communities and local governments, that's an attractive proposition. It also gives Saigontel leverage in negotiations — the ability to present a project as a regional economic development story, not just a real estate play, tends to accelerate permitting timelines and unlock incentive structures.
Reading the Investment Calculus
For investors and developers eyeing this space, Saigontel's land reserve strategy deserves careful analysis rather than reflexive enthusiasm.
The upside case is clear. Vietnam offers lower land costs than Singapore or Hong Kong, a young and growing digital economy, improving fiber connectivity, and a government that has signaled openness to foreign technology investment. A well-positioned land bank in that environment appreciates in value even before development begins. If hyperscale cloud providers — the Amazons, Googles, and Microsofts of the world — continue their push into Southeast Asian markets, they'll need local partners with shovel-ready sites. That's exactly what Saigontel is building toward.
The risks, though, are real and shouldn't be hand-waved away.
Power infrastructure remains a genuine constraint. Vietnam has faced electricity shortages in recent years, and while the government has ambitious renewable energy targets, the transmission grid in some provinces hasn't kept pace with industrial demand. A data center site without a credible path to 50+ megawatts of reliable power isn't a data center site — it's an expensive field.
Geopolitical and regulatory risk also warrants attention. Vietnam's data localization laws are evolving, and the requirements placed on foreign cloud operators affect how much capacity actually gets built domestically versus served from regional hubs. The land reserve strategy only pays off if the policy environment continues to welcome the kind of large-scale foreign-operated infrastructure that fills those buildings.
Currency risk, construction cost inflation, and the concentration of development know-how in a relatively small talent pool round out the risk picture. None of these are dealbreakers, but sophisticated investors price them in.
Where Data Center Land Strategy Is Heading
Saigontel's approach reflects a broader shift in how serious infrastructure developers think about land — not as something you find when you need it, but as a strategic asset class you accumulate when conditions allow.
The constraint is shifting. Five years ago, the bottleneck in data center development was often capital. Today, in high-demand markets, it's frequently land and power. Developers who recognized that transition early — and built land positions accordingly — are now in a structurally advantaged position relative to competitors who are scrambling.
Technology is reshaping site requirements at the same time. The rise of AI workloads has pushed power density requirements dramatically higher — where a traditional enterprise data center might run at 5-10 kilowatts per rack, AI training clusters can demand 50-100 kW per rack or more. That changes land use math. You may need less physical footprint than you expected, but you need dramatically more power infrastructure per square meter. Sites with proximity to high-voltage transmission, good grid stability, and potential for on-site power generation — solar, backup gas, eventually hydrogen — command a premium.
Water access for cooling is emerging as another site selection criterion that wasn't on most developers' radar a decade ago. As liquid cooling adoption grows alongside higher-density compute, proximity to water sources and local regulatory frameworks around water use will factor into which sites actually get developed.
